is this petri contamined? (pic)
    #4310099 - 06/18/05 02:39 AM (18 years, 8 months ago)

something alien and strange is growing in my petri dishes.
like a contam, it starts from the sides and moves towards the centre, while the myc starts from the centre and goes to the sides.
unlike contams it's not green or red or purple or any fancy colors: it looks transparent, just a little darker than the agar medium, which is brownish. maybe a bacterial contamuination? do they look like this? it is my first petri contam.
soon this thing and the myc will meet.
what shall i do?

i added a little h2o2 to the agar mix this time for the first time (3rd generation). 1.5ml h2o2 to 200ml agar mixture (0.75%), added just before solidification. i will transfer a "healty" part of myc from the previous generation in each dish. my choice for a healthy mycelium follows these rules:

1) myc from a non contamined looking dish over myc from a contamined looking dish
2) rhizomorphic myc over cottony myc
3) faster running myc over slower running myc (running from the centre to the edges of the petri dish of course).

in this way i'm hoping to isolate a fast, rhizomorphic and contam resistant substrain. only after that i will test its fruiting capabilities.
